About this school

Sol Christian Academy is an independent school in Manchester. It teaches children aged 2 to 18 and has 34 pupils on roll.

Ofsted has not yet inspected Sol Christian Academy under its current framework. Where the Department for Education has published them, its results and pupil characteristics appear below. Numbers and a report only go so far, so visit in person before you apply.

Ofsted judgement

Sol Christian Academy has not been inspected by Ofsted yet. It opened in its current form in June 2013, and new or converted schools usually wait a few years for their first inspection.

Progress 8 is paused nationally for the 2024/25 and 2025/26 school years. Those pupils sat no key stage 2 tests during the Covid pandemic, so there is no starting point to measure progress from. A blank figure here is not missing school data.
